ABSTRACT:
A water degreaser system which recycles and reclaims absorbing fluid. Freon absorbing fluid is used in a wet spiral absorber-contactor to absorb oil contaminants in produced-water. A downflow spreader system in a processing separator separates the heavier freon from the decontaminated water. Unspent freon is recycled to the absorber-contactor and the clean water is released into the surrounding environment. Spent freon is reclaimed in a distillation treatment unit where the oil is drained off and stored. The freon vapors are drawn off under vacuum from the distillation unit by a jet pump, mixed and condensed with the decontaminated water which drives the jet pump, and then redirected into the system for reuse.
